### Changed defaults

While hunting the leaked file descriptors in Fennwick's batch poller, we found the old idle-socket reaper defaults masked the leak for days. We tightened the reaper interval and lowered the open-handle ceiling so leaks surface fast and page on-call early. The new shipped defaults are as follows.

settings of fafog-haduf:
ZORIX_PIN=4648
ZORIX_METRICS_HOST=metrics.zorix.paliqsys.corp
ZORIX_LOG_LEVEL=info
ZORIX_TENANT=druix

Subject: Large-deal discounting — quick read before Thursday

Team, ahead of the board session: we're proposing to cap large-deal discounts at 20% firm-wide for Meridale Software, with anything above routed through the new pricing council. Yes, sales will grumble, but modelling shows we recover roughly two points of margin with minimal win-rate impact. Happy to walk through the numbers Thursday. Confidential note on the related business plans appears below.

management briefing: Project Ulavan slips by two quarters because of the staffing delay.

Quarterly Planning Note — Inventory Write-Down

For the incoming director: Caldermoor Supply will book a 2.4m write-down on obsolete Halvern-line stock this quarter. Disposal via the Renbeck liquidator is arranged. Warehouse capacity in Ashgrove frees up by March. No restatement needed. The freed capacity serves the confidential plan noted below.

confidential, baduf-yaduf: Quenmirix Group plans to raise the Briys list price by 6 percent in November.

Handover: Exportron retry queue

Hi Mira — handing over the failed-export retries. Exports that hit a timeout land in the retry queue and get three attempts with backoff; after that they're parked and need a manual requeue from the admin panel. Watch for customers reporting duplicates — that usually means a double requeue. The current retry settings are as follows.

settings of bajog-fawig:
oliael:
  log_level: warn
  metrics_host: metrics.oliael.zemvarsys.internal
  pin: 0267
  pool_size: 32